《oracle 11 空表导出》正文开始,本次阅读大概3分钟。
Oracle 11是一款强大的数据库管理系统,它可以完成各种数据操作任务。在我们使用Oracle 11的过程中,我们有时需要将表的数据导出到其他应用程序中。今天,我们将重点讨论Oracle 11空表的导出操作。
导出Oracle 11空表的过程非常简单。我们只需要在SQL命令行输入以下语句即可:
exp username/password@servername owner=ownernametables=tablenamequery='"where 1=2"' file=filename.dmp
如上所述,我们需要在exp命令中指定用户名、密码和服务器名。此外,我们还需要指定表的所有者名称和表名称。在本例中,我们还需要为查询指定“where 1=2”条件,这将确保我们只导出空表。
我们还需要将导出文件的名称指定为“filename.dmp”。注意,我们可以自行选择导出文件的文件名和路径。
下面是一个例子,说明如何使用exp命令导出名为employee的空表:
exp scott/tiger@db10g owner=scott tables=employees query='"where 1=2"' file=c:\emptyemp.dmp
上面的命令将在c:\emptyemp.dmp中导出employee表的结构。请注意,此文件只包含表结构,而没有任何数据。
总之,导出Oracle 11空表是一个简单而基本的任务。通过在exp命令中使用query='where 1=2'条件,我们可以确保我们只导出空表结构。
在正式执行导出操作之前,请仔细检查命令并充分了解exp命令的其他用途和参数。这将确保我们获得最佳的结果。